Output 6669ca151fb8b0088660021ae17e694b452d3f09e300013c5a2801a65cdebcb6:1

value
2026230926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7cc13206ec723a7e93ecb4168518dcfc1d01819 OP_EQUAL
address
3JSr41SXXhWj3yenSg85t3nAA23b548gGx
transaction
6669ca151fb8b0088660021ae17e694b452d3f09e300013c5a2801a65cdebcb6
spent
true